The Sun (London), 8 Oct 1854
THE RUSSIAN PRISONERS
Four Russian officers and two ladies, 365 soldiers, seven women and two children, who arrived in the Nile steamer from Sheerness, were landed at Plymouth yesterday, and taken on to the Millbay prison.
It also mentions the "... Russian prison ships ..." at Sheerness and another batch of prisoners being taken on board by the Preussischer Adler , bound for Plymouth.
